The items in this shop are brilliant & so delicious. They bake fresh daily so you know you are not getting yesterday's bread & everything they make is without the preservative 232 in it. Bonus. There is also a loyalty card that means you get free loaves & that's fantastic because you can actually save the free ones up & just got in to get them for nothing.
The staff are always well mannered & well dressed. Christmas time is super busy but they seem to cope well.
Shop is very clean as well, and they offer tasting of some of their best sellers & that's always a great thing as well.Overall this bakery is worth paying that little extra compared to the Coles store it is right next to because you know it's all fresh & baked right there. You can even watch them bake it through the window.
